HLD vs. LLD : Principal Distinctions and Practical Applications
The basic distinction between architectural blueprints and LLD resides in their scope . HLD focus on the general structure of a solution, outlining key modules and their connections without diving into coding details . In contrast , Low-level designs provide a thorough blueprint for precisely each component will be constructed , encompassing data structures , methods, and interfaces . Practically , an HLD might define that an online shopping platform will have components for goods cataloging , shopper copyright , and payment handling , while the detailed specification would elaborate the exact database structure for product information and the algorithms used for recommendation modules.
